The Workflow Inbox
Use
You can use the Workflow Inbox to integrate the SAP Business Workplace inbox into the CIC application area.
Prerequisites
You maintain the profile for the Workflow Inbox (WF_INBOX) in Customizing under SAP Utilities ® Customer Service ® Customer Interaction Center ® Establish Settings for Workflow Inbox Component.
You also need to include the WF_INBOX component with the profile you have just maintained on a tab page in the application area.
You can enter the profile name and an explanatory text on the Workflow Inbox Profile level of the view cluster. On the Task filter level, you can enter tasks of your choice (single-step or multistep tasks) or task groups as filters. If you do this, then only work items whose underlying tasks correspond to these criteria will be displayed in the Inbox. If you do not maintain the filter settings, then all work items that are displayed in the general SAP Business Workplace Workflow Inbox will also be displayed here.
Task group TG20500002 (for IS-U) and task group TG26000001 (for IS-M) contain all the tasks supplied by SAP that are intended for use in the CIC.
Users can in any case only see work items that they have authorization to process. The task filter is simply intended as a supplementary way of limiting these work items.
Inbound documents (for example, e-mails) or customer requests for callbacks can also be displayed in the Workflow Inbox. To do this make the necessary settings in Customizing under SAP Utilities ® Customer Service ® Customer Interaction Center ® Define Process for Inbound Documents and Define Process for Customer Callbacks
